Block

#18,597,412
Block Number
18,597,412 @ 05/23/2024, 22:06:00
Status
Finalized
ID
0x011bc6246985d3919731b7b32e0a0ec064aa93aedb07d8cfbbaec20baea1e029
Transactions
Gas Used
0/34708200 (0.00% Used)
Total Score
1,812,451,618 (+96)
Rewards
0.00 VTHO